        /// <summary>
        ///     Asynchronously obtains a grant of <paramref name="requestedBytes"/> for the requesting <paramref name="username"/>.
        /// </summary>
        /// <remarks>
        ///     This operation completes when any number of bytes can be granted. The amount returned may be smaller than the
        ///     requested amount.
        /// </remarks>
        /// <param name="username">The username of the requesting user.</param>
        /// <param name="requestedBytes">The number of requested bytes.</param>
        /// <param name="cancellationToken">The token to monitor for cancellation.</param>
        /// <returns>The operation context, including the number of bytes granted.</returns>
        public Task <int> GetBytesAsync(string username, int requestedBytes, CancellationToken cancellationToken)
        {
            var group  = Users.GetGroup(username);
            var bucket = TokenBuckets.GetValueOrDefault(group ?? string.Empty, TokenBuckets[Application.DefaultGroup]);

            return(bucket.GetAsync(requestedBytes, cancellationToken));
        }

        /// <summary>
        ///     Returns wasted bytes for redistribution.
        /// </summary>
        /// <param name="username">The username of the user that generated the waste.</param>
        /// <param name="attemptedBytes">The number of bytes that were attempted to be transferred.</param>
        /// <param name="grantedBytes">The number of bytes granted by all governors in the system.</param>
        /// <param name="actualBytes">The actual number of bytes transferred.</param>
        public void ReturnBytes(string username, int attemptedBytes, int grantedBytes, int actualBytes)
        {
            var waste = Math.Max(0, grantedBytes - actualBytes);

            if (waste == 0)
            {
                return;
            }

            var group  = Users.GetGroup(username);
            var bucket = TokenBuckets.GetValueOrDefault(group ?? string.Empty, TokenBuckets[Application.DefaultGroup]);

            // we don't have enough information to tell whether grantedBytes was reduced by the global limiter within
            // Soulseek.NET, so we just return the bytes that we know for sure that were wasted, which is grantedBytes - actualBytes.
            // example: we grant 1000 bytes. Soulseek.NET grants only 500. 250 bytes are written. ideally we would return 750
            // bytes, but instead we return 250. this discrepancy doesn't really matter because Soulseek.NET is the constraint in
            // this scenario and the additional tokens we would return would never be used.
            bucket.Return(waste);
        }
